Solar Exposure and Varicose Veins : What Users Need Understand

While sunlight is important for vitamin D creation and overall wellness , its impact on varicose blood vessels is intricate . Intense sunlight doesn’t trigger varicose veins ; they’re primarily due to heredity , years of age, and choices factors like being overweight and being on your feet. Still, present varicose lines might appear more apparent due to alterations in complexion and swelling from sun exposure. Thus , safeguarding from excessive sunlight is frequently a prudent practice for those with twisted veins to avoid likely irritation and tone injury.

Can Sunlight Worsen Your Varicose Veins?

Does sun really aggravate those unsightly veins ? The short truth is that prolonged sun light doesn't directly cause varicose veins. However, it might exacerbate existing issues. Sun rays to the surface around varicose veins can be more noticeable , and higher heat can sometimes increase swelling . It’s crucial to protect your skin with a sunblock and clothing when out in the sun to minimize these possible effects.
